Codice Fiscale for buying property in Italy

If you are planning to buy a house or apartment in Italy, a Codice Fiscale is commonly required during the legal, banking and notarial stages of the transaction. Arranging it early can help prevent avoidable delays.

Why property buyers need it

Italian professionals and authorities use the Codice Fiscale to identify parties to many legal and financial transactions. It can be requested by estate agents, banks, notaries and other professionals involved in a property purchase.

When should you obtain it?

It is sensible to arrange the code before you reach a stage where a bank, notary or contract requires it. The exact timing depends on your purchase process, but obtaining it early gives you more flexibility if documents need clarification.

Can you apply while living abroad?

In many cases, yes. The correct administrative route depends on your residence, nationality and circumstances. Our service is designed to support international applicants remotely where the applicable route permits it.

What should you prepare?

Have a valid passport or identity document, your full legal name, date and place of birth, nationality, current residential address and contact information ready. We review the submitted information before it moves to the next stage.
